Transaction 5e670c02351904e3c177854ddecfecfa6078487ea62099058d1a9e38ce261b80
1 Input
1 Output
-
5e670c02351904e3c177854ddecfecfa6078487ea62099058d1a9e38ce261b80:0
- value
- 197598
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9bc55a29ea4c64b35f689f4f777f7f1f44191b4 OP_EQUAL
- address
- 3MYJAt8K34oDFyBYWbE1xZNRdp94tV3PdH